Liliha Bakery Limited specializes in a selection of baked goods for the residents of Honolulu and the Neighbor Islands area in Hawaii. The family business offers a range of oven-fresh cakes and pastries. It provides ensemadas, butter horns, turnovers, doughnuts and coco puffs. Liliha Bakery Limited sells more than 7,200 puffs every day. The bakery also offers grilled mahimahim, beef stew, pancakes and Portuguese sausages. It operates a coffee shop that serves frozen strawberry sundae, veal patty cutlets, and apple and banana pies. In addition, the coffee shop provides corn chowder, chicken noodle and Italian wedding soups. Liliha Bakery Limited provides custom-designed cakes for special celebrations and fundraising programs.

A local favorite of mine

Next door to Chinatown, the Takakuwa family has been serving island-style diner food for more than a half-century. One of the last remaining 24-hour bakery-diner combinations in Honolulu, it is practically a landmark made famous by chantilly-covered coco puffs followed closely by Chantilly Cake (chocolate cake with buttercream frosting.) Take your sponge cake with buttery frosting with you or join happy locals at the formica counter.
